The recent Fred Rogers film Won’t You Be My Neighbor has become the highest grossing biographic documentary of all time. For most Mister Rogers’ neighborhood’s 31 season run, pianist Johnny Costa provided the jazzy accompaniment that millions grew up on. Wynton Marsalis says Costa was called “Baby [Art] Tatum.”
Costa recorded four outstanding solo piano albums for Chiaroscuro that highlights his imagination and artistry.
